Verdicts 3.4x worse than champion. ### Replay research (Aug 9) — the root-cause finding - arXiv 2502.06042: finetuning on limited target data overfits AND drifts; injecting ~1%+ pretraining data into the mixture prevents both. - arXiv 2401.05605: LoRA still forgets; perf↔forgetting is inverse-linear and NOT fixable by rank/epochs/early-stopping → replay is the lever. - **What we were doing wrong:** every adaptation ran on DOMAIN-ONLY gold (~115K assistant tokens) with zero pretraining-data replay. - Full note: `docs/replay_research.md`. Replay rule added to `skills/tiny-model-training/SKILL.md`. ### LoRA run ii (Aug 9) — replay - Replay ratio 0.5 from `train_phase2b.bin`, KL 0.1, lr 2e-4, 1 epoch. - Result: ppl **7.54** (better than base), free-form OPENS with clean domain English then degrades; main 0.020 / res **0.167** (champion-level) / combined 0.060. Replay fixed fluency, not main-verdict discrimination. ### Adapter-only DPO (Aug 9) — 2 runs, dead end - Run A (lr 1e-4, beta 0.1): dpo_loss → 0.0015, ppl EXPLODED to 913 by step 100. Harness research + decision-spine build (2026-08-09) — "punch like 7B" ### Research (arXiv, 2026-08-09, multi-source) - Verbalized confidence is ANTI-CALIBRATED: ORCE (2026-05), Direct Confidence Alignment (2025-12), "Probabilistic vs Verbalized Confidence" (arXiv 2408.11774). => never trust a self-reported HIGH/MEDIUM/LOW label; map it to measured accuracy. - Small models need STRONG EXTERNAL verifiers to self-correct (arXiv 2404.09931 "SLMs Need Strong Verifiers"). => the verify loop is deterministic suit logic (rule spine + retrieval + value checks), never weak self-critique. - Selective prediction / governed abstention is the SLM production recipe: abstain below a calibrated threshold, publish accuracy-at-coverage (governance-ready SLM 2025-08; conformal selective prediction 2026-07). - Self-consistency: sample N, but WEIGHT by calibrated reliability instead of naive majority (arXiv 2203.11171; Universal SC 2311.08110). - RLVR: Reasoning Gym (2025-05) = library of verifiers for RLVR — supports the deterministic-spine direction (recorded; not this week). - Chain-of-Verification (Meta 2023-09) + RAG+CoVe (2024-10): draft -> verify -> revise; verification must be external (see strong-verifier finding). ### What this means for FSI-Anomaly The 25M brain cannot be trusted to grade its own answers or pick its own confidence. The suit must: (1) sample/collect votes, (2) weight them by the calibration table, (3) abstain below threshold, (4) log chain-of-custody. That is the "punch like 7B" mechanism for our narrow domain — reliability through the system, not the parameter count. ### Built this session (all recorded; unit-tested) - research/calibration.py — label -> measured accuracy (+ Wilson CI, HIGH-bucket verdict mix, abstention stats); writes logs/calib_summary_.json. - research/decision.py — decision spine: weighted_tally, decide (p_final = mean calibrated reliability behind winner; governed abstention), accuracy_vs_coverage (selective-prediction curve), bucket_abstention_curve, trace (chain-of-custody). Fixed 2 regex bugs found by tests (4.2M split, 9:30am trailing-\b). - Remaining applies (planned): weighted self-consistency sampler N=3-5; calibrated fusion (replace naive confidence raise); context budget in TUI; RLVR with decision spine as verifier. ## 16. 150M-on-tablet feasibility research (2026-08-09) ### Research question Can we train a 150M parameter model on the Exynos 1580 tablet (8-core ARMv9, 7.4GB RAM + 12.3GB swap) with our existing disciplined loop? ### Sources (measured, not guessed) - **tiny-scale skill** (2026-08-06): measured throughput table, RAM ceiling, coherence floor. 25M = 430 tok/s, 19h/epoch. Extrapolation: 150M ≈ 50-100 tok/s, 95-190h/epoch (4-10 days). RAM at 150M ≈ 2.0-2.5GB per step (weights + AdamW + activations). Fits in physical RAM (7.4GB) but swap risk for AdamW state. - **tiny-model-phase2 skill** (2026-08-06): VERIFIED winning path is wide-head tower growth from trained trunk (identity-init). Width upscaling 320→512 FAILED (val loss 2.58→6.1-7.7). Depth-only 12.94M worked. Tower growth hybrid18m (16.77M) and hybrid25m (25.4M) both preserved baseline EXACTLY (val 2.5784 == baseline). SCAN_CHUNK=16 critical for numerical stability. Corpus mixing MUST be window-shuffled balanced (train_phase2b.bin), not concatenated blocks. - **tiny-model-training skill**: replay ratio 0.5 mandatory (arXiv 2502.06042, 2401.05605), LoRA on grown base preferred over full SFT. ### Findings 1. **150M is technically feasible on this device** — fits in physical RAM, training will complete. BUT iteration speed drops 5-10×. One epoch = 4-10 days. A failed hyperparameter guess = 1 week lost. 8-run study at 25M took weeks because iteration was daily; at 150M it would be monthly. 2. **Coherence ceiling is ~28M** (TinyStories class). 25M hybrid25m is AT this ceiling. Going to 150M doesn't improve coherence for open-ended generation; it only adds capacity for more specialized SFT/DPO. 3. **The harness IS the product** — decision.py, fusion.py, verify_loop.py, guardrails.py, calibration system, helix memory, dual-mind fusion, SOP agent. These apply to ANY model size. Building them on 25M is faster and produces the same grant-worthy artifacts. 4. **Growth path is proven** — hybrid25m tower from trained 320-dim trunk. If capacity is needed, the next step is hybrid28m (tower_d=512, tower_blocks=12 or tower_d=768, tower_blocks=8), not 150M from scratch. ### Decision **Do NOT pursue 150M on tablet now.** The iteration penalty is too high for disciplined development. Tokenizer stage OOM bug found + fixed (2026-08-11) - The 528M full re-encode kept dying. ROOT CAUSE: data/reencode.py did `for i in mm.tolist()` on the WHOLE memmap -> Python list of 528M ints (~19 GB) > 7.2 GB RAM + 11 GB swap -> OOM-killed (phase2b worked at 32.5M tokens ~1 GB). The "streaming" claim in the docstring was wrong. - FIX: iterate in chunks (`range(0, len(mm), args.chunk_tokens)`), seg/buf persist across chunk boundaries so EOT-lines spanning chunks stay intact. RSS now ~300 MB. py_compile clean. - Progress: tokenizer16k.json (16384 vocab) + train_phase2b16k.bin (31.2M tok) + valid16k.bin (5.38M tok, 12s) done. BUG FIX: MTP head drift broke DPO load (2026-08-12) - SYMPTOM: chain auto-launched DPO after SFT final, but train_dpo.py crashed every attempt (13-15+) with "Missing key(s): mtp_heads.0.0.bias, mtp_heads.1.0.bias". - ROOT CAUSE: code/checkpoint drift. The saved SFT checkpoints have MTP heads with WEIGHT only (no bias); the current model code builds MTP heads as nn.Sequential(nn.Linear(...,bias=True), SiLU) -> expects bias. So ref model has mtp bias, sd lacks it -> strict load fails. (MTP is pretrain-only per tiny-model-mtp; unused in generation.) - FIX (surgical, doctrine-aligned): in train/train_dpo.py, research/eval.py, train/ties_merge.py -> set cfg.mtp_heads = 0 (no MTP post-training) and load with strict=False (tolerate the 2 stray mtp weight tensors). Smoke test: 0 missing / 2 unexpected (the ignored mtp weights). Verified before relaunch. - Relaunched chain_post_sft_v22.sh detached -> auto-fires DPO now that SFT done. ## 47. Skill `tiny-model-posttrain` forbids this pattern going forward. - Root-cause finding (measured, 2026-08-13): the 3,004 preference pairs are SCHEMA-MISMATCHED with the v22 SFT — all pairs use the old analyst stamp format ("Step 1..N", "Verdict: X. Confidence: Y.", persona=analyst only), while `data/sft_v22.jsonl` (119 rows) is the new Spock conversational schema ("<|scratchpad|>...<|final|>I consider this ..."; personas analyst 74 / skeptic 10 / spock 35). DPO optimized toward an incompatible style. (Verified by grep counts: 3004 'Step 1' + 3004 'Verdict:' vs 0 'I consider' in prefs; 1 'I consider' style in SFT.) - `best_ppl.pt` (step 200, val_ppl 9.37) and the SFT best (`ckpt/hybrid50m_v22_lora/best.pt`) have NEVER been battery-eval'd. 25M precedent: DPO3@200 mid-training checkpoint was the champion. The candidate-eval gap is the #1 measurement to close. ### Research (2026-08-13, multi-source, on-device) - LFM2 technical report (arXiv 2511.23404): exact three-stage ending — (1) SFT; (2) length-normalized direct alignment: joint loss L = -E[ w*f(Δ-m) + λ*g(δ) ] with Δ = r_w/|y_w| - r_l/|y_l|, δ = σ(r_w/|y_w|) - σ(r_l/|y_l|), r = β log(πθ/πref); DPO = special case (w=1, m=0, λ=0), LFM2 adds margin m=0.1 + APO-zero term λ=0.2. Preference data mixes on-policy (N=5 sampled from the SFT ckpt) + off-policy. (3) Merging = apply soup / task arithmetic / TIES / DARE / DELLA IN PARALLEL, evaluate, keep best. §4.5: small models fail evals on format — robust parsing, report parse failures separately. - DPO behavior evidence: D-STEER (arXiv 2512.11838) — DPO acts as a low-rank steering perturbation; it changes behavior, not beliefs (matches: DPO moved the STYLE, not the verdict discrimination). Output diversity collapse in post-training (arXiv 2604.16027) — post-trained models homogenize outputs (matches the single-class collapse). - DPO over-optimization/verbosity: arXiv 2406.10957 (down-sampled KL), arXiv 2602.06239 (PEPO), arXiv 2506.08681 (importance sampling). - Small-model alignment: arXiv 2502.17927 (advantage-guided distillation — alignment gains diminish on SLMs), arXiv 2511.06512 (EASE, edge safety). - Big-tech recipes re-verified: Llama 3.2 (1B/3B) = iterative rounds of SFT -> Rejection Sampling -> DPO (model card); SmolLM2 = SFT then DPO 1 epoch (UltraFeedback, alignment-handbook); LFM2 SFT = ~5.39M samples. - SFT data floor: tiny-model-reasoning stands — 1,500-3,000 hand-authored gold rows; we are at 119 (huge gap; 119 teaches format, not judgment). ### Skills applied / created (2026-08-13) - UPDATED `tiny-model-posttrain` — LFM2-verified length-normalized joint objective, parallel merging + eval selection, checkpoint-selection rule, v22 schema-mismatch failure record. - UPDATED `tiny-model-eval` — collapse detector (>70% single class / anti-calibration = flag), tokenizer-match rule (8k default crashes on 16k checkpoints — logs/eval_50m_20260812_1649.log), candidate battery discipline (eval every candidate; red-team through the full pipeline). - CREATED `tiny-model-multiturn` — multi-turn coherence + real-task end-to-end verification gate (owner's pre-release blocker; LFM2 §4.1/§4.5, MT-Bench 2306.05685). - UPDATED `tiny-model-roadmap` — current status + re-ordered next steps. - All mirrored to `~/.codex/skills/` and `/root/.shared-skills/`. ### Corrected next steps (proper order, skills applied) 1.
